International Ido Conventions
- 2012: Dessau, Germany
- 2011: Echternach, Luxembourg (Information), 24 participants from 11 countries
- 2010: Tübingen, Germany (Information)
- 2009: Tallinn, Estonia (Information)
- 2008: Wuppertal-Neviges, Germany, participants from 5 countries (Information)
- 2007: Paris, France, 14 participants from 9 countries (Information, Photos)
- 2006: Berlin, Germany, approx. 25 participants from 10 countries (Information)
- 2005: Toulouse, France, 13 participants from 4 countries (Information)
- 2004: Kiev, Ukraine, 17 participants from 9 countries (Information)
- 2003: Großbothen, Germany, participants from 6 countries (Information)
- 2002: Kraków, Poland, 14 participants from 6 countries (Information)
- 2001: Nuremberg, Germany, 14 participants from 5 countries (Information)
- 1998: Białobrzegi, Poland, 15 participants from 6 countries
- 1997: Bakkum (mun. Castricum), Netherlands, 19 participants from 7 countries
- 1995: Elsnigk, Germany
- 1991: Ostend, Belgium, 21 participants
- 1980: Namur, Belgium, 35 participants
- 1960: Zürich, Switzerland, ca. 50 participants
